Understanding the Core Mechanics
At its heart, the gameplay in these types of games revolves around timing and precision. Players must carefully observe the movement patterns of oncoming traffic, identifying gaps and opportunities to safely guide their chicken across. The speed of the traffic often increases as the game progresses, demanding quicker reflexes and more strategic thinking. Many games introduce power-ups or special abilities that can aid the player, such as temporary invincibility or the ability to slow down time. These elements add another layer of complexity and excitement to the experience. Mastering these core mechanics is crucial for achieving high scores and unlocking new content. The feeling of narrowly avoiding a collision provides a rush of adrenaline, making each attempt feel exhilarating.

Utilizing Power-Ups and Boosts
Power-ups can be game-changers, providing temporary advantages that can significantly increase your chances of success. Carefully timing the activation of these boosts is crucial. A shield power-up, for example, should be saved for moments when a collision is unavoidable. Similarly, a speed boost can be used to quickly traverse a particularly dangerous section of the road. Understanding the duration and limitations of each power-up is also important. Some power-ups may only last for a few seconds, while others may have a limited number of uses. Strategic use of these resources can transform a challenging level into a manageable one.

Responsible Gaming Considerations
While the casino-style elements can be fun, it’s essential to practice responsible gaming habits. This means setting limits on your spending and playing time, and avoiding the temptation to chase losses. It's important to remember that these games are designed to be addictive, and it's easy to get caught up in the excitement. If you find yourself spending more money or time than you intended, it's crucial to take a break and reassess your habits. Treat these games as a form of entertainment, and never gamble with money that you can't afford to lose. Being mindful of your behavior and setting healthy boundaries will ensure that you can enjoy the game without experiencing any negative consequences.
